#fefbd4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fefbd4 is composed of 99.6% red, 98.4%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.2% magenta, 16.5%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 55.7 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 91.4%. #fefbd4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#fdf7a9. Closest websafe color is: #ffffcc.

Shades and Tints of #fefbd4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0d00 is the darkest color, while #fffff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#fefbd4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#eaeae8 is the less saturated color, while #fefbd4 is the most saturated one.
